These speakers are great at what they do. You're not going to get the deep rumbling bass, but you will get a balanced, good overall sound. I use them for my Creative Zen Vision W, connecting via the auxiliary in on the front panel. They get loud enough, without becoming murky. The only annoying thing is the super bright blue LED power light...but I put a piece of electrical tape over this right away - problem solved.
To sum up, I'd recommend these as a good sub-$100 set of speakers for PC and mp3 players. They're not perfect...but if you're an audiophile, you're probably not looking at this price range anyway.

I recently purchased these speakers from a local store (rebate deal). The first pair was defective right out of the box (left channel would not work at all). After a trip back to the store, the second pair seemed to work -- for a month. Then, the left channel would get this horrible static on it (this is without even having anything plugged into it except power). Turning it off for a few minutes would fix the problem, but why bother with this? I took those back to the store and got my THIRD pair. Now those seem to work fine (so far). Well, now that I have a working pair, I love them. At high volumes the bass breaks up, but this is to be expected. At moderate volumes, these things sound great! They are not studio monitors, but they are probably as close as you are going to get for under a C-note. The sound is crisp and clear, and the auxiliary input on the front is a nice touch. My only real complaint is that the stupid blue LED on the front of the right speaker is WAY to bright, but a little electrical tape can fix that. If you get one that works, highly recommended.

I wanted a small set of speakers with good sound quality for my home office desktop. I didn't need incredibly powerful speakers, but I wanted something I could listen to at moderate intensity levels and receive good sound reproduction.
For overall sound quality, the Klipsch Pro Media 2.1 speakers are better (in my opinion) and the Klipsch subwoofer certainly provides a better gaming experience. But, for my small office space, a subwoofer didn't make sense and these are perfect for listening to music at moderate levels.
With the $20 rebate recently offered, I considered these to be an excellent bargain! However, even without the rebate, I would be pleased with the quality and performance.

I had a 2.1 system before, but this Creative T20 has a much better sound. Especially because the bass is stereo too (comparing to 2.1 systems which bass is out mono).
Talking about bass, I don't understand what people expected from bass. These speakers DO have bass!!! A lot!!! I think people sometimes mass bass with wall-shaking. Bass is for the ear, not for the wall (actually wall-shaking distort the original sound).
I perceived that the sound tends (specially when closer to the speakers) tends to get better with time.. at the first day sounded halo, but it has improved after 3 days.
Mode than adequate bass, middles, and highs. All sound great! Solid construction too. I have it for 1 month now and I love it!
Just remember to cover the bass Xport when not using to avoid dust..
